Output 12ba5c3732249bc8d53b66ef2c7d89a34c87fb8baef035c986c4b78b332046fb:6

value
24629879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1c57ede707edc8f0b0c6c1c00e2c7ed844831bb OP_EQUAL
address
MT2L3kpXxc2pYurdYGHof5sbNmuMEdQFGg
transaction
12ba5c3732249bc8d53b66ef2c7d89a34c87fb8baef035c986c4b78b332046fb
spent
true